Bill Summary
AN ACT to amend the public authorities law, in relation to the Fair Fares act
AI Summary
This bill expands the Fair Fares NYC program, which currently offers a fifty percent fare discount on designated transit options, to include individuals whose income is up to three hundred percent of the federal poverty level, in addition to those already eligible for the program. This expanded eligibility will grant these individuals a fifty percent discount on trips taken on the Long Island Rail Road, paratransit services, New York City transit subways or buses, and the Metro-North railroad. The bill also mandates a public outreach campaign to inform eligible individuals about the program and encourage its use.
